YMCA Kids Triathlon returns to Doylestown

Posted

YMCA of Bucks and Hunterdon Counties will host its first Kids Triathlon since 2019 at the Doylestown branch on Sunday, Sept. 25.

The YMCA Kids Tri has been an annual event for the community since 2008, but was paused along with other events since 2020. The 12th annual Kids Tri will be held from 7:30-11 a.m. and is open to athletes ages 3 to 14. 

The YMCA Kids Tri is a swim, run and bike event incorporating indoor and outdoor use of the Doylestown branch, including the pool, parking lots and surrounding neighborhood streets.

Courses are configured to the age groups, respectively, featuring a special “Weebees” course for 3- to 5-year-olds accompanied by an adult. The theme of this year’s event is “Compete to Complete,” celebrating all who enter and complete their course with a fun, single-podium finish line experience. 

Featured at this year’s Kids Triathlon is the Kids Tri Village, including shaded waiting areas, refreshments, activities and live music by Bobby Beetcut. For more information, visit https://www.ymcabucks.org/seasonal-events/kids-tri, as well as sign up for the free transitional clinic, Thursday, Sept. 22 from 6-7 p.m. at the Doylestown branch.

The transitional clinic teaches young triathletes how to set up their transition area for moving from swim to bike, and bike to run in preparation to “Compete to Complete” the triathlon.
